Know the level of your depression. There are several gradations of depression that can vary from a mild case to much more severe. Mild depression are experienced by many people and some of them have no idea they are depressed. Mild depression might just feel like the blues, whereas moderate depression negatively affects daily life. Clinical depression is severe and it may cause the sufferer to have behavioral changes that include becoming disinterested in the world and experiences behavior changes.
